卸载通过 Pip 安装的软件包
要删除活动虚拟环境中使用 pip 安装的所有软件包,请考虑以下方法:
方法 1:标准方法
步骤 1: 使用以下方法检索已安装软件包的列表:
pip freeze
步骤2:使用以下方法一一卸载:
pip uninstall <package_name>
方法2:一键删除
如果您更喜欢更有效的方法,请使用以下命令:
pip freeze | xargs pip uninstall -y
其他注意事项:
排除 VCS 软件包:
如果通过版本控制安装软件包系统 (VCS),排除它们:
pip freeze --exclude-editable | xargs pip uninstall -y
处理从 Git/GitLab 安装的包:
直接从这些平台安装的包将具有语法“@例如:
django @ git+https://github.com/django.git@<sha>
要删除它们,请首先使用以下命令提取包名称:
pip freeze | cut -d "@" -f1
然后使用以下命令卸载它们:
xargs pip uninstall -y
以上是如何删除虚拟环境中通过 Pip 安装的所有软件包?的详细内容。更多信息请关注PHP中文网其他相关文章!